I don&#039;t believe the E Cigarette should affect your insurance policies based on the fact that their definition of whether you are a smoker refers to whether you smoke tobacco cigarettes. E cigarettes do not fall under this category and this is another reason why they are legal to smoke indoors, despite a smoking ban being placed on the traditional tobacco cigarettes.
However, I would still clarify with your insurer nonetheless, to avoid any confusion.</description>

		<description>The proposal is to ban unlicensed nicotine products which are currently regulated by the General Products Safety Regulations, the Poisons Act, CHIP regulations for packaging and CE certification.  All nicotine products will have to be either tobacco or licensed medicines.
